Are daybeds full or twin?

Daybeds come in a variety of sizes, and can be full-sized or twin-sized. Full-sized daybeds measure 54″ x 75″, while twin-sized daybeds measure 39″ x 75″. A full-sized daybed can also be used as a sofa and allows you to fit two people comfortably, while a twin-sized daybed works great when you need an extra bed for a single person.

If you’re looking for an extra bed for a guest room or a cozy reading nook, a twin-sized daybed is an ideal choice. Both full-sized and twin-sized daybeds are available in a variety of styles and designs, so you can easily find one to match the rest of your decor.

What kind of mattress do you use for a daybed?

When deciding on a mattress for a daybed, it is important to consider what type of material and firmness you prefer. Popular mattress types for daybeds are innerspring, memory foam, hybrid, latex foam, and air-filled mattresses.

Innerspring mattresses are some of the most common types used on daybeds. They are made of coiled springs wrapped in fabric and come in a variety of comfort levels, ranging from firm to super soft. Innerspring mattresses provide good support, enabling the user to move freely without feeling too much sinkage.

Memory foam mattresses are ideal for those who want body-contouring comfort. Memory foam mattresses are also great for motion isolation and they come in a variety of firmness levels. Hybrid mattresses are similar to innerspring mattresses but contain a top layer of memory foam to provide both comfort and support.

Latex foam mattresses are perfect for those who want body-contouring support, as they are incredibly supportive and firm. They also conform to the body, providing a comfortable sleeping experience. Air-filled mattress are unique because they allow the user to adjust the firmness to their preference.

They are also hypoallergenic, making them ideal for those who suffer from allergies.

The type of mattress you choose for your daybed should be guided by your personal sleeping preferences. Consider your preferred comfort level and body type when deciding which type of mattress is best for you.

What is the weight limit for a daybed?

The weight limit for a daybed will vary depending on the type of daybed and the frame. Most twin-sized daybeds are constructed of wood, metal, or wicker, and will generally support a weight of up to 250 to 330 pounds.

Larger sizes, such as full and queen daybeds, will typically hold more weight. When in doubt, check the manufacturer’s weight limit before purchasing a daybed. Additionally, if the daybed will be used as a sofa, consider the weight of uninvited visitors who may decide to plop on it.

If the frame is made of wood and not reinforced with metal, it may not hold up to extended usage or the extra weight of people jumping on it.
